A Carlow man has been rescued after a fall on the Comeragh Mountains this evening.
The alarm was raised at approximately midday after he fell into a gully in the Mahon Falls area.
The South Eastern Mountain Rescue team were alerted by local gardaí and following an almost three hour operation the man was removed from the scene shortly after 4.30pm.
The experienced climber was taken to hospital with lower leg and arm injuries and a spokesperson for the rescue team has described it as a very complex rescue due to the uneven terrain.
